Country music superstar Eric Church has exciting news for his fans! He’s expanding his highly successful “Free The Machine Tour” by adding 24 brand new shows throughout 2026. This extension includes stops in several major cities across North America.
New Dates Added for 2026
The tour kicks off its extended run on January 22-23, 2026, at The Anthem in Washington, D.C. Fans in cities like Toronto, Kansas City, Buffalo, Tulsa, Birmingham, Austin, and Charlotte can look forward to catching Church live. The tour is set to wrap up its extended leg on April 11, 2026, at the Benchmark International Arena in Tampa, Florida.
Special Guests on Tour
Joining Eric Church on various dates of the “Free The Machine Tour” will be a lineup of talented special guests. These include artists such as Ella Langley, Kashus Culpepper, Caylee Hammack, Ashley McBryde, and Stephen Wilson Jr. Church shared his excitement on Instagram, saying, “The Free the Machine Tour is off to an incredible start, and new shows have just been added. Look forward to Caylee Hammack, Ella Langley, 49 Winchester, Stephen Wilson Jr., Ashley McBryde and Kashus Culpepper as new special guests for these dates.”
How to Get Tickets
General public tickets for the newly added shows will go on sale starting October 3, 2025, at 10 AM local time.
For loyal fans who are premium members of the “Church Choir,” a special pre-sale opportunity begins on September 29. Members are advised to check their emails for further details and visit ericchurch.com or the official Eric Church app.
Non-premium members of the “Church Choir” can also register for early access through Seated, starting September 30.
